So, this is a bit semantics but with Suncor, the policy generally applies through the contractor, not Suncor directly. In the event a contractor employee is selected for a post-incident or random drug test, the testing process is usually administered and documented by that employee’s own company, even if the client site like Suncor provides the facility or third-party professionals involved in the test itself. In other words, refusing a drug test is typically treated first as a refusal to comply with the employer’s requirements and not directly refusing a test from Suncor.

From there, it is up to the discretion of the contractor company to decide how they handle it. They may keep the reporting fairly general, or they may choose to report the refusal and details to the client if they feel vindictive or simply a need to discipline the behavior. If the company decides to escalate it to Suncor by reporting the testing and it leading to a refusal, that can lead to serious consequences, including a permanent Suncor site ban. In practice, those bans can be very difficult to reverse because Suncor, like most oil sands companies, are reluctant to devote time and resources to frivolous personnel investigations.

There also seems to be a lot of industry talk that this kind of information can follow people beyond a ban of just Suncor sites and could extend to other oil sands sites through some sort of information sharing agreement or informally via word of mouth. That said, the exact outcome is very circumstantial but usually depends on the contracting company that employs the employee in question.

As for whatever reasoning your friend said he had for refusal, unfortunately, it’s irrelevant whether he believes they are personally justified or not. It’s irrelevant in that it is established during orientation, before entering any Suncor site or doing any work on site that submitting to a drug test with short to little notice for the purpose of random selection testing or post incident testing is one of the terms of employment. They also establish that refusal to do so can and most likely will result in a permanent site ban. Everyone who has ever worked on a Suncor site specifically signs an acknowledgement that they understand and accept these terms, so it ‘should be’ no surprise to anyone what happens.
